How Walls Go From Framed to Finished

The crew hangs sheetrock, tapes seams, applies joint compound, and sands until the surface is smooth and level. In Texarkana projects, drywall finishing is done in multiple coats with drying time between passes, ensuring seams and fastener holes disappear under paint or texture.

When the work is complete, you run your hand along the wall and feel no ridges, bumps, or depressions. The surface takes paint evenly, and the seams are invisible under typical lighting conditions.

How long does drywall installation and finishing take?
A single room may take two to three days including drying time, while larger spaces or multi-room projects can take a week or more depending on square footage and the level of finish required.
Can you match existing wall texture?
Yes, the crew matches texture patterns such as orange peel, knockdown, or smooth finishes so repairs blend with surrounding areas. Samples are tested before application to ensure consistency.
What is included in drywall repair?
The crew cuts out damaged sections, installs new sheetrock, tapes and mudds seams, sands the surface smooth, and primes the area so it is ready for paint. Water-damaged or crumbling drywall is fully replaced.
How many coats of joint compound are applied?
Typically three coats with sanding between each pass. The first coat embeds the tape, the second widens and smooths the seam, and the third feathers the edges for an invisible finish.
